What is Knowledge?

FitraFoundation
About this episode

In the Name of Allah, Most Merciful and Compassionate 

What is knowledge?  What distinguishes sacred knowledge?  What is metafiqh? 

Epistemology is a branch of philosophy that deals with the theory of knowledge. Unique and brilliant in its approach, Islamic tradition has its own epistemology. Devoid of academic doublespeak and highly succinct, these lessons offer a guide to this critical topic accessible to laymen and experts alike.
